WebThe tool calculates an accelerated biweekly payment, for example, by taking your normal monthly payment and dividing it by two. Since you would pay 26 biweekly payments, by the end of a year you would have paid the equivalent of one extra monthly payment. WebThis calculator shows you possible savings by using an accelerated biweekly payment on your auto loan. By paying half of your monthly payment every two weeks, each year your auto loan company will receive the equivalent of 13 monthly payments instead of 12. WebLet’s look at an example of a do-it-yourself biweekly mortgage: Loan amount: $200,000. Mortgage rate: 4.25% (30-year fixed) Regular monthly mortgage payment: $983.88. 1/12 of that amount: $81.99. New combined payment (paid just once a month): $1,065.87. Total savings: $30,205 in interest.
